this is by far the best zoo to take children to in Japan that I visited so far. It has lots of Hands-On exhibits, and many enclosures that you can walk around inside of with the animals. Of course, these are only with safe animals, like kangaroos and wallabies.it's large enough for all animals to seem comfortable with the amount of space they have, and there are plenty of different play and rest areas for both older and little ones. There's a park in the center of the zoo where kids can play on a slide, and it ropes course we're larger kids and adults can test their strength and endurance on a good weather day. Parking is cheap, around 600 Yen a day. It is definitely worth checking out if you're in the area. I drove about an hour to get there, and we'll be doing the same again many times in the future.
